Understanding Roundup and Its Active Ingredient
Roundup is a non-selective herbicide, meaning it can kill most plants it comes into contact with. Its active ingredient is glyphosate, a chemical that inhibits a specific enzyme found in plants, essential for the synthesis of certain amino acids. Without these amino acids, plants cannot survive, leading to their death. Glyphosate is systemic, meaning it is absorbed by the plant and distributed throughout its tissues, including the roots, ensuring a thorough kill.
Glyphosate’s Mechanism of Action
Glyphosate works by inhibiting the enzyme 5-enolpyruvylshikimate-3-phosphate synthase (EPSPS), which is crucial in the biosynthesis of aromatic amino acids. These amino acids are vital for the production of proteins and other essential compounds in plants. By blocking EPSPS, glyphosate effectively starves the plant of necessary nutrients, leading to its demise. This mechanism of action is specific to plants and does not affect animals or humans in the same way, making glyphosate a widely used herbicide for weed control.

Oxalis: The Weed in Question
Oxalis, also known as sour grass or wood sorrel, is a perennial weed that can grow in a variety of conditions. It has clover-like leaves and can produce small, yellow flowers, followed by seed pods that explosively disperse seeds. Oxalis can be particularly troublesome in lawns, gardens, and agricultural fields, competing with desired plants for water, nutrients, and light.
Why Oxalis is Challenging to Control
One of the reasons oxalis is difficult to control is its ability to produce bulbs and tubers that can survive herbicide applications and regenerate new plants. These underground storage organs allow oxalis to persist even after the above-ground portions of the plant have been killed. Effective control of oxalis often requires a multi-faceted approach, including repeated herbicide applications, physical removal, and cultural practices that favor desired vegetation.

Does Roundup Work on Oxalis?
The effectiveness of Roundup on oxalis depends on several factors, including the concentration of the herbicide, the method and timing of application, and the overall health and density of the oxalis population. Glyphosate can effectively kill the above-ground portions of oxalis, but its impact on the underground bulbs and tubers is more variable. In some cases, especially with lower concentrations or improper application, glyphosate may not fully penetrate to the underground storage organs, allowing the oxalis to regrow.
Factors Influencing Roundup’s Effectiveness on Oxalis
Several factors can influence the effectiveness of Roundup on oxalis. These include:
- Application Rate and Timing: The concentration of glyphosate and the timing of its application can significantly impact its effectiveness. Higher concentrations may be more effective but also increase the risk of non-target damage and environmental contamination.
- Weed Size and Density: Larger, more established oxalis plants may require higher application rates or repeated treatments to ensure adequate control. Similarly, dense populations may shield some plants from the herbicide, reducing overall effectiveness.
Alternative and Integrated Control Strategies
Given the challenges of controlling oxalis with herbicides alone, integrated pest management (IPM) strategies are often recommended. These approaches combine physical, cultural, biological, and chemical controls to manage weed populations more effectively and sustainably. For oxalis, this might include regular mowing to prevent seed production, improving soil health to favor desired vegetation, and using mulches or Barrier fabrics to prevent oxalis from emerging.

How long does it take for Roundup to kill Oxalis?
The time it takes for Roundup to kill Oxalis can vary depending on several factors, including the concentration of the herbicide, the method of application, and the growth stage of the plant. In general, Roundup can start to take effect within a few days of application, with visible symptoms of injury, such as wilting and yellowing, appearing within 7-14 days. However, it may take several weeks or even months for the Oxalis to completely die, as the herbicide works its way through the plant’s system and kills the underground tubers.
The rate of kill can also be influenced by environmental factors, such as temperature, humidity, and soil type. For example, Roundup may work more quickly in warm and sunny weather, as this allows for optimal absorption and translocation of the herbicide.
